Cyprus hybrid compression energy storage project
The Cyprus Department of the Environment has approved the construction and operation of a modern energy storage facility with a capacity of 59 MW and a storage capacity of 120 MWh in the Psevdás community in the Larnaca district. Estonia Energy solar Energy Storage Project
Developer Evecon and investment manager Mirova have unveiled plans for Estonia's largest solar-storage hybrid project, combining a 77. 5 MW photovoltaic (PV) plant with a 55 MW / 250 MWh battery energy storage system (BESS). Solar 12V DC power project installation cost
The average residential solar installation costs about $2. 90 per watt, making a typical 6-kilowatt system approximately $17,400 before incentives.
FAQs about Solar 12V DC power project installation cost
How much does a new solar system cost?
The amount that you'll pay for a new solar power installation varies based on the size of the system, which depends on the desired goal. Although the national average spent on solar power is around $18,000 before incentives and rebates, and most pay between $15,000 and $25,000 for a 6kW system.
How much does a residential solar panel cost?
Residential solar panel prices typically range from $15,000 to $30,000 before any applicable tax credits or incentives. Costs depend on several factors: System Size: Larger systems usually have higher upfront costs but can lead to more significant energy savings.
How much does solar power cost?
Although the national average spent on solar power is around $18,000 before incentives and rebates, and most pay between $15,000 and $25,000 for a 6kW system. Some homeowners start with a smaller system to power their air conditioner, range, or clothes dryer, since these appliances use a great deal of electricity.
How much does a commercial solar system cost?
On average, commercial solar systems cost between $2.50 and $4 per watt. Therefore, a 100 kW installation might range from $250,000 to $400,000. Battery costs vary significantly based on capacity, type, and brand. Understanding these factors helps you determine the best option for your needs.
What are the capital costs of a solar system?
Capital costs, often referred to as upfront costs, are the expenses incurred during the acquisition and installation of the PV system. These include: Cost of Solar Panels: This is typically the most significant part of the capital costs. The price depends on the type and number of panels.
How much does solar installation cost?
According to the NREL data above, installation typically accounts for 5.5% of the total cost of a residential solar project, so this equation will get you a ballpark figure for labor costs. For example, if you receive a solar quote for $25,000, you can expect labor to make up around $1,375 of the all-in cost.

What is the vanadium battery contract project
Located in the Hongqiqu Economic and Technological Development Zone in Linzhou, the project spans approximately 143 acres. It includes the construction of a 100MW/600MWh vanadium flow battery energy storage system, a 200MW/400MWh lithium iron phosphate battery energy storage system, a 220kV step-up substation, and transmission.
FAQs about What is the vanadium battery contract project
Is vanadium the future of battery energy storage?
The use of vanadium in the battery energy storage sector is expected to experience disruptive growth this decade on the back of unprecedented vanadium redox flow battery (VRFB) deployments.
What is a vanadium flow battery?
It is considered to be one of the most promising energy storage technologies. Rongke Power has over 450 patents in vanadium flow battery technology, saying their flow battery systems are operational in key regions globally.
What are vanadium batteries?
Vanadium batteries are long-lasting and economical energy storage systems. They are the technology of choice for energy storage, and Vecco is integrating the mining of high purity vanadium and alumina with the manufacturing of battery components to support the global decarbonisation transition.
What is the world's largest vanadium flow battery project?
Dalian, China-based vanadium flow battery (VFB) developer Rongke Power, has completed a 175MW/700MWh project, which they are calling the world's largest vanadium flow battery project. Located in Ushi, China, the project will provide various services to the grid, including grid forming, peak shaving, frequency regulation and renewable integration.
How long can a vanadium flow battery last?
Rongke Power's vanadium flow batteries can provide continuous energy storage for over 10 hours and the company says they are highly recyclable and adaptable, support various sizes of projects, from utility-scale to commercial applications.
What is a vanadium redox flow battery?
According to research published in 2021 in Advances in Smart Grid Power Systems, compared with other chemical energy storage technology, the vanadium redox flow battery has advantages in safety, longevity and environmental protection. It is considered to be one of the most promising energy storage technologies.

Does American Samoa have a geothermal energy plan?
The 2016 American Samoa Energy Action Plan identifies some geothermal resources, but none of these are viable for commercial electricity generation. The 2016 plan instead emphasizes the development of wind and solar power (Ness, Haase, and Conrad 2016). American Samoa is exploring opportunities for both offshore and onshore wind power generation.
Why is Energy Justice important for American Samoa?
Energy justice is an important concept for American Samoa due in part to energy affordability issues. As Table 8 demonstrates, the approximate baseline home electricity burden in American Samoa in 2019 was 5.45%—compared to an approximate baseline U.S. home electricity burden of 2.11%.
How much electricity does American Samoa use?
Annual estimated electricity consumption in American Samoa is low compared to U.S. consumption (4.38 MWh and 10.65 MWh, respectively); it is the cost of electricity and median household income that are the main drivers of the territory's home electricity burden.
Can American Samoa develop wind power?
American Samoa is exploring opportunities for both offshore and onshore wind power generation. In 2022, federal legislation opened offshore waters around the U.S. territories (including American Samoa) to wind power development.
